MetaMask(メタマスク)でのNFT送信手順と失敗しない注意ポイント





MetaMask(メタマスク)でのNFT送信手順と失敗しない注意ポイント


MetaMask(メタマスク)でのNFT送信手順と失敗しない注意ポイント

本稿では、最も広く利用されているブロックチェーンウォレットであるMetaMask(メタマスク)を用いたNFTの送信手順について、技術的・運用的な観点から詳細に解説します。NFT(Non-Fungible Token)は、デジタル資産としての価値を持つ唯一無二のトークンであり、アート、ゲームアイテム、ドキュメントなど多様な分野で活用されています。その送信は単なる操作ではなく、資産の移動を意味するため、誤った操作が生じると不可逆的な損失につながる可能性があります。

特に初学者や、ブロックチェーン環境に慣れていないユーザーにとっては、送信手順の理解不足や注意点の見落としがリスクを引き起こす要因となります。そのため、本記事では、正しく安全にNFTを送信するためのステップバイステップのガイドラインを提供するとともに、実際のトラブル防止に役立つ重要な注意事項を網羅的に提示します。

1. MetaMaskの基本機能とNFT対応について

MetaMaskは、Ethereum(イーサリアム)ネットワークをはじめとする複数のブロックチェーンプラットフォームに対応するウェブウォレットです。ユーザーはこのツールを通じて、自身の鍵ペア(プライベートキーとパブリックキー)を管理し、スマートコントラクトとのやり取り、トークンの送受信、およびNFTの購入・譲渡を行うことができます。

MetaMaskは、ブラウザ拡張アプリケーションとして動作し、Chrome、Firefox、Edgeなどの主要ブラウザに対応しています。インストール後、新規アカウントの作成または既存アカウントの復元が可能であり、セキュリティ面においても、ユーザー自身が鍵を保持する「自己責任型」の設計が採られています。

NFTの送信においては、MetaMaskが提供する「送信(Send)」機能が中心となります。ただし、この機能は通常のトークン送信とは異なり、特定のコントラクト仕様に基づいて動作するため、正しいネットワーク設定と適切なトランザクションフィールドの入力が必須です。

2. NFT送信前の準備:確認すべき5つのステップ

正確な送信を行うためには、事前準備が極めて重要です。以下の5つの項目を必ず確認してください。

  • ネットワークの確認:送信先のNFTがどのブロックチェーン上に存在するかを確認します。主な例として、Ethereum、Polygon、BSC(Binance Smart Chain)などがあります。MetaMask内で現在接続しているネットワークが、送信対象のNFTと一致している必要があります。不一致の場合、トランザクションは失敗または資金の消失につながります。
  • ウォレットの残高確認:送信前に、自身のウォレットに十分なガス代(Gas Fee)が残っていることを確認します。NFT送信には、ネットワーク上の処理コストとしてガス代が必要です。特に急激なネットワーク混雑時、ガス代が高騰するため、事前に予測可能な範囲内で送信を計画することが推奨されます。
  • 送信先アドレスの検証:送信先のウォレットアドレスが正しいか、念のため再確認を行います。アドレスの1文字の誤りでも、資金は永遠に回収不可能になります。また、送信先が公式サイトや取引所のアドレスである場合、その正当性を第三者の確認手段(例:公式ドメインの確認、公式ツイッターの発表など)で裏付けることが重要です。
  • NFTの種類とコントラクト情報の確認:一部のNFTは、特定のスマートコントラクトに紐づいているため、送信時にコントラクトのインターフェースに準拠した処理が必要です。特に、ERC-721やERC-1155などの標準プロトコルに準拠していないカスタムコントラクトのNFTは、送信方法が異なる場合があります。公式プラットフォームからの情報を参照し、送信方法を明確にしましょう。
  • セキュリティ設定の確認:MetaMaskの設定で、「トランザクションの通知」「外部サイトへのアクセス許可」などを適切に管理しているかを確認します。不要なアクセス権限を与えることで、悪意あるサイトからウォレット情報が流出するリスクが高まります。
重要:送信前に、テスト用の小さな金額の送信(例:0.001 ETH)を実施して、手順の正しさを検証することを強くおすすめします。これは、実際の資産を損失する前に問題点を発見する有効な手法です。

3. 実際の送信手順:ステップバイステップガイド

以下は、MetaMaskを使用してNFTを送信する具体的な手順です。すべての操作は、MetaMaskの拡張機能を介して行います。

  1. MetaMaskの起動とネットワーク選択:ブラウザの右上隅にあるMetaMaskアイコンをクリックし、ログインを行います。その後、左下のネットワーク選択メニューから、送信対象のNFTが存在するネットワークを選択します(例:Ethereum Mainnet)。
  2. NFTの表示と選択:ウォレット内の「トークン」タブを開き、必要に応じて「NFT」タブに切り替えます。ここに登録されたすべてのNFTが一覧表示されます。送信したいNFTをクリックして詳細情報を確認します。
  3. 「送信」ボタンの選択:NFTの詳細画面で「送信(Send)」ボタンを押下します。これにより、送信用の入力フォームが表示されます。
  4. 送信先アドレスの入力:「送信先アドレス」欄に、受け取り側のウォレットアドレスを正確に入力します。コピー&ペーストを利用する際は、改行や余白がないか確認してください。アドレスの末尾に誤字がある場合、トランザクションは無効化されます。
  5. ガス代の確認と調整:MetaMaskは自動的にガス代を計算しますが、必要に応じて「ガス代の変更」オプションで速度とコストのバランスを調整できます。高速処理を希望する場合は「高速」モードを選択しますが、それにより費用が増加します。通常の送信であれば、「標準」モードで十分です。
  6. トランザクションの承認:すべての項目が正しく入力されたら、「送信(Send)」ボタンを押下します。その後、MetaMaskのポップアップウィンドウが表示され、トランザクション内容の確認が求められます。この段階で、送信先アドレス、送信数量(1)、およびガス代が正しく表示されているかを再確認してください。
  7. 承認と送信:確認が完了したら、「承認(Approve)」をクリックします。これにより、ブロックチェーンにトランザクションが送信され、ネットワーク上で処理が始まります。処理時間はネットワーク状況によって異なりますが、通常数秒〜数分以内に完了します。
注意:トランザクションが承認された後は、キャンセルできません。ブロックチェーン上の記録は永久に残るため、誤送信の可能性を極力排除するために、あらゆる確認を怠らないようにしましょう。

4. 失敗する主な原因とその回避策

NFT送信が失敗する理由は多岐にわたりますが、以下の代表的なケースと対処法を紹介します。

  • ネットワーク不一致:例えば、Polygon上に存在するNFTをEthereumネットワークに送信しようとした場合、トランザクションは無効になります。解決策は、事前にネットワークの識別を行い、正しく設定することです。
  • 送信先アドレスの誤り:アドレスの1文字でも間違えると、資金は回収不可能です。回避策として、アドレスを2回以上読み上げる、あるいは専用のアドレス検証ツール(例:Blockchair、Etherscanのアドレス検証機能)を併用することを推奨します。
  • ガス代不足:送信時のガス代が足りない場合、トランザクションは「失敗」として処理され、ガス代は消費されますが、送信は行われません。これを避けるには、ウォレットに常に余剰のETH(Ethereum)を保有しておくことが重要です。
  • スマートコントラクトの制約:一部のNFTは、送信を制限するコントラクトロジック(例:ロック期間中、特定のアドレスのみに送信可能など)を備えています。このような場合、送信はエラーで終了します。事前に公式ドキュメントやコミュニティの掲示板を確認しましょう。
  • マルウェアや詐欺サイトの利用:悪意あるサイトが偽の「送信」ボタンを設置し、ユーザーのウォレットを乗っ取ろうとするケースがあります。必ず公式サイトや信頼できるプラットフォームから操作を行うようにし、リンクの確認を徹底してください。

5. セキュリティ強化のためのベストプラクティス

資産を守るためには、単なる操作ミスの防止だけでなく、長期的なセキュリティ習慣の構築が不可欠です。以下に、最も効果的なセキュリティ対策をまとめます。

  • プライベートキーの厳重保管:MetaMaskの初期設定時に生成される12語のバックアップフレーズ(パスフレーズ)は、絶対に第三者に共有してはいけません。紙に書き出して安全な場所に保管するか、ハードウェアウォレットに保存することを推奨します。
  • 2段階認証(2FA)の導入:MetaMask自体には2FA機能がありませんが、関連するサービス(例:Google Authenticatorによるメールアドレス認証)を併用することで、アカウントの盗難リスクを大幅に低下させられます。
  • 定期的なウォレット監視:EtherscanやPolygonscanなどのブロックチェーンエクスプローラーを使って、ウォレットのトランザクション履歴を定期的に確認しましょう。異常な送信や未承認のトランザクションがあれば、すぐに対応可能です。
  • 不要なアプリのアクセス許可の削除:MetaMaskで許可されたアプリは、一度許可すると、長期間有効なままになることがあります。不要なアプリのアクセス権限は、設定から定期的に削除しましょう。

6. トラブル発生時の対応方法

万が一、送信失敗や誤送信が発生した場合の対応策を紹介します。

  • トランザクションが失敗した場合:Etherscanなどでトランザクションのステータスを確認します。ステータスが「Failed」であれば、ガス代は消費されますが、送信は行われていません。再送信は可能です。
  • 誤送信の発生:アドレスが正しいものの、相手が意図せず送信した場合、原則として返金はできません。ただし、相手に連絡をとり、協力を依頼する形で交渉を行うことは可能です。この際、誠実な態度と証拠(送信履歴)を示すことが重要です。
  • ウォレットの乗っ取り疑い:突然、送信が行われた、またはアドレスが変更されたと感じたら、即座にパスフレーズの再確認を行い、他のデバイスからログインしていないかをチェックしてください。必要に応じて、新しいウォレットを作成し、資産を移管しましょう。
補足:NFTの送信に関する問い合わせは、多くの場合、プラットフォーム運営者や取引所に直接依頼する必要があります。しかし、ブロックチェーン自体は分散型であり、運営者が介入できる範囲は限られているため、事前の注意が最も重要です。

7. 結論:慎重な行動こそが資産を守る鍵

本稿では、MetaMaskを用いたNFT送信の全過程を丁寧に解説し、失敗を防ぐための注意点を体系的に整理しました。特に、ネットワークの一致、アドレスの正確性、ガス代の確保、そしてセキュリティ設定の徹底は、資産保護の根幹をなす要素です。また、誤送信や不正アクセスのリスクを回避するためには、日常的な監視習慣と、情報の信頼性を確認する姿勢が不可欠です。

NFTは、デジタル時代における新たな資産形態であり、その価値は今後さらに増大する可能性があります。一方で、その非中央集権性と不可逆性は、ユーザー個人の責任をより強く求めます。したがって、送信のたびに「本当に正しいか?」という問いを自分自身に投げかけることこそ、安全なブロックチェーンライフを送るための最良の戦略です。

最後に、本記事の内容を踏まえ、次の3点を心に留めてください:

  • 送信前に、必ずアドレスとネットワークを2回以上確認する。
  • 実際の資産よりも小さい金額でテスト送信を行う。
  • すべての操作は、公式かつ信頼できるプラットフォームから行う。
本記事を通じて、MetaMaskを用いたNFT送信の正確な手順と、失敗を回避するための重要なポイントを体系的に学びました。これらの知識と習慣を日々実践することで、ユーザーは安心してデジタル資産を管理・流通でき、未来のブロックチェーン社会に貢献する基盤を築くことができます。


前の記事

MetaMask(メタマスク)でトランザクションが失敗する原因と解決方法

次の記事

MetaMask(メタマスク)の送金手数料が高い?ガス代節約のテクニック

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です